Peach Cobbler Cake

Peach Cobbler Cake is a tender vanilla cake with pieces of fresh peach throughout. The cake is topped with a brown sugar streusel and vanilla glaze. It makes a delicious breakfast or dessert!

Ingredients

Servings

Crumb Topping

  • 1 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1/3 cup brown sugar packed
  • 1/3 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 ½ teaspoons ground cinnamon
  • 1/4 teaspoon ground nutmeg
  • 6 tablespoons butter melted

Cake

  • 2 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1/2 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1/2 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1/3 cup vegetable oil
  • 1/4 cup sour cream
  • 1/4 cup buttermilk
  • 3/4 cup granulated sugar
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1 cup diced fresh peach

Icing

  • 1 cup powdered sugar
  • 2-3 tablespoons milk

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 325 F. Grease a 9x5-inch loaf pan; set aside.
  2. In a medium bowl, stir flour, sugars, cinnamon, and nutmeg together.
  3. Pour in melted butter, and stir to combine. Set aside.
  4. In a separate medium bowl, whisk together flour, baking soda, baking powder, and salt. Set aside.
  5. In a large bowl, whisk vegetable oil, sour cream, buttermilk, and sugar together until combined.
  6. Whisk in eggs and vanilla extract until well-combined.
  7. Whisk in dry ingredients until combined.
  8. Fold in diced peach.
  9. Pour batter into prepared pan.
  10. Top with crumb mixture.
  11. Bake for 50-65 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
  12. If topping begins to get too brown, tent with aluminum foil.
  13. Let loaf cool in pan for 10 minutes.
  14. Remove cake to wire cooling rack.
  15. Whisk powdered sugar and 2 tablespoons milk together.
  16. Add in additional milk as needed to get thick but pourable consistency.
  17. Drizzle icing over the top of cooled bread.
  18. Let icing set before slicing.

Notes

  • Butter: I use salted butter. If you would like to use unsalted butter, add a pinch of salt to the topping.
  • Buttermilk: If you don't have buttermilk, you can make a substitute with this recipe.
  • Peaches: You could use frozen peaches. If you use frozen peaches, don't thaw before use.
